How do I increase bass on Windows 10?

Right-click the speaker icon on the taskbar and select Playback Devices from the pop-up menu.

  1. Select the speakers in the list (or any other output device for which you want to change the settings), and then click the Properties button.
  2. On the Enhancements tab, check the Bass Boost box and click the Apply button.

What is the best equalizer setting for bass in a car?

Set your equalizer to all-flat (all settings at zero), bass boost OFF, and any other sound enhancement disabled. For systems using amplifiers, be sure you're not using a bass boost for the subwoofers.

How should I set my bass amp?

Play music through your receiver at about one-quarter volume. Turn up the gain of the subwoofer amp until the sound from your subwoofer completely overpowers the other speakers, without distorting. Turn the gain up until it distorts, then back it off until the sound is clean again.

How do I increase the bass on my Logitech speakers?

Look through each tabbed section of the "Speakers Properties" page for a setting that allows you to adjust the bass. Many sound cards provide settings to change the "Bass Boost" and "Bass Balance." These settings can often be found under the "Enhancements" tab.
